In Wallace, you can expect to pay between $25 and $45 per night for standard dog boarding. The price often varies based on the dog's size and whether you choose a private suite or a standard run. For the most accurate pricing, it's best to contact local Wallace kennels directly.

You should bring your pet's regular food to avoid stomach upset and any required medications with clear instructions. Given Wallace's sometimes unpredictable weather, it's also wise to bring a familiar blanket or item from home for comfort. Don't forget your vet's contact information, including a local emergency vet number.
Reputable boarding facilities in Wallace have established protocols with local veterinarians for emergency situations. They will require your vet's information and an emergency contact number for you. Most will also have a standing relationship with a specific veterinary clinic in the Wallace area or nearby Dillon for immediate care.
Yes, all reputable Wallace kennels require proof of current vaccinations, typically including Rabies, DHLPP, and Bordetella (kennel cough). It's crucial to provide this documentation from your vet ahead of your pet's stay. Some facilities may also recommend flea and tick prevention due to the rural nature of the area.
